Shraddha Kapoor confirms Chhoti Stree to drop these big hints leading into Stree 3’s storyline
The Maddock Horror Comedy Universe is revealing an animated film, Chhoti Stree, which will pave the way for Stree 3.
The Maddock Horror Comedy Universe is set for an exciting new adventure, and this time it’s animated. At the launch event for Thamma, actor Shraddha Kapoor confirmed that the upcoming film, Chhoti Stree, will be essential in unveiling the backstory of Stree for the much-anticipated Stree 3.

Shraddha Kapoor shares insights on Stree 3
Calling Chhoti Stree her favorite segment, Shraddha expressed her enthusiasm: “When Dinoo (Dinesh Vijan) informed me about it, I exclaimed, ‘Seriously, your name should truly be Dinesh Vision!’”. The film is intended as a theatrical animated feature, catering to kids, families, and franchise fans alike.
Producer Dinesh Vijan added that Chhoti Stree functions as more than a mere spinoff; it acts as a fascinating link to Stree 3. “Most excitingly, Chhoti Stree will conclude with a sequence leading into Stree 3. It will shift from animation to live-action, addressing the question: ‘What is Stree’s backstory?’” he shared.
Scheduled for release six months before Stree 3, Chhoti Stree promises a mix of humor and lore, marking a significant addition to Maddock Films’ ambitious horror-comedy narrative.
Exploring the Stree franchise
The Stree franchise has established itself as a major player in the horror-comedy genre for Maddock Films. The original film, Stree (2018), starred Rajkummar Rao and Shraddha Kapoor. Made on a budget of approximately ₹20 crore, it ultimately grossed over ₹180 crore worldwide.
Following that success, Stree 2 exceeded expectations, bringing in over ₹801.15 crore globally in just 35 days, according to box office sources. With spinoffs like Roohi and Bhediya, the Maddock Horror Comedy Universe now boasts a cumulative gross of over ₹1,000 crore, solidifying its legacy as one of India’s premier genre franchises.
